Product Overview

HMS Anybus AB7065-C Replacement/Upgrade Solution for Communicator Series: Smooth Migration from Legacy PROFIBUS to Modbus RTU Systems

The HMS Anybus AB7065-C is a field-proven industrial protocol gateway that bridges PROFIBUS DP-V1 master/slave networks with Modbus RTU serial devices — a critical link in countless legacy automation architectures across manufacturing, process control, water treatment, and energy sectors. Seamless Upgrade Solutions: Migration Components for PROFIBUS–Modbus RTU Systems

A successful AB7065-C replacement rarely involves the gateway alone. In most retrofit projects, the gateway sits at the intersection of a Siemens S7-300 or S7-400 PLC acting as the PROFIBUS DP master, and a bank of Modbus RTU field devices — variable-frequency drives, smart meters, flow controllers, or third-party I/O blocks. When the AB7065-C is swapped, the surrounding system components must be verified for compatibility.

On the PROFIBUS side, the DP master interface card — such as a Siemens CP 342-5 or the onboard DP port of a CPU 315-2 DP — continues to operate without modification, since the replacement gateway presents an identical PROFIBUS slave profile. The GSD file is re-imported into STEP 7 or TIA Portal, the slave address is matched, and the DP network topology remains unchanged. If the installation uses a PROFIBUS repeater or RS-485 bus terminator to extend segment length, those components are unaffected.

On the Modbus RTU side, the existing RS-485 wiring to downstream devices — whether a Schneider Electric ATV312 drive, an energy meter, or a third-party remote I/O module — is reconnected to the same terminal block pinout. Baud rate, parity, stop bits, and Modbus slave addresses are re-entered via the ACM software, which reads and writes the same configuration file format used on the original AB7065-C. No PLC program changes are required if the I/O data mapping is preserved.

For plants running mixed protocol environments, the AB7065-C replacement integrates cleanly alongside other Anybus Communicator gateways in the same control cabinet — for example, an AB7007 handling PROFIBUS-to-DeviceNet conversion or an AB7072 bridging EtherNet/IP to Modbus RTU. All units share the same DIN rail mounting profile and 24 VDC power rail, simplifying cabinet layout and spare-parts inventory.

Where the legacy system includes a Siemens ET 200S or ET 200M distributed I/O rack connected via PROFIBUS, the gateway replacement does not affect those nodes — they remain on the same DP segment and continue to exchange data with the PLC independently. Similarly, if a Siemens OP 277 HMI or third-party panel PC is connected via MPI or PROFIBUS, its communication path is unaffected by the gateway swap.

For customers planning a broader migration from PROFIBUS to Industrial Ethernet, the AB7065-C can serve as a transitional device while the Modbus RTU field layer is gradually replaced with EtherNet/IP or PROFINET capable devices. In that scenario, an Anybus X-gateway AB7628 (PROFIBUS DP to PROFINET IO) may be introduced in parallel, allowing the PLC to be migrated to a Siemens S7-1500 or Allen-Bradley ControlLogix platform without disrupting the existing Modbus RTU field devices during the transition period.

Signal isolation is another consideration in aging installations. If the RS-485 segment shows noise or ground loop issues, a Phoenix Contact MINI MCR signal isolator or equivalent DIN rail isolator can be inserted between the AB7065-C serial port and the field cable without any configuration change to the gateway itself.

Retrofit Guidance FAQ

Q: Do I need to rewire the PROFIBUS connector when replacing the AB7065-C?
No. The replacement unit uses the same DB9 female PROFIBUS connector and the same pin assignment. The existing cable, termination resistors, and bus address switch settings are transferred directly. Only the PROFIBUS slave address needs to be confirmed and matched on the new unit.

Q: Will my existing PLC program need to be modified?
In most cases, no. The replacement gateway presents the same I/O data structure to the PROFIBUS master. If the GSD file version differs, re-import the new GSD in STEP 7 or TIA Portal, verify the I/O module configuration matches the original, and perform a hardware configuration download. The PLC application program (OB, FB, FC blocks) does not require modification if the data mapping is unchanged.

Q: How do I transfer the Modbus RTU configuration from the old unit to the new one?
Use the Anybus Configuration Manager (ACM) software. If you have the original .abcfg project file, open it and download it to the new gateway via the USB configuration port. If the original file is lost, the configuration can be reconstructed by reading the Modbus register map from the field device documentation and re-entering the polling commands in ACM. TOPNLMS can provide ACM setup guidance as part of after-sales support.

Q: Is the AB7065-C compatible with PROFIBUS DP-V0 masters, or only DP-V1?
The AB7065-C supports both DP-V0 and DP-V1 operation. It can function as a standard DP-V0 slave when connected to older masters that do not support acyclic DP-V1 services. No configuration change is required — the gateway automatically adapts to the master’s capability level.

Q: What is the physical installation space requirement?
The AB7065-C occupies approximately 45 mm of DIN rail width. The replacement unit has the same form factor. No additional cabinet space is required, and the existing cable management and ferrite clamps can be reused.

Q: Can the gateway operate in an ATEX Zone 2 environment?
The standard AB7065-C carries ATEX Zone 2 certification. Please confirm with TOPNLMS at the time of order whether the replacement unit in stock carries the same ATEX marking, as certification variants may differ by production batch.

Q: What commissioning steps are required after installation?
After physical installation and wiring: (1) Set the PROFIBUS slave address using the rotary switches. (2) Download the ACM configuration to the gateway. (3) Power on and verify the PROFIBUS RUN LED. (4) Trigger a Modbus RTU poll from the gateway and verify response from field devices. (5) Perform a PLC hardware configuration download if the GSD file was updated. Total commissioning time for an experienced engineer is typically under two hours for a direct replacement.
